Linux命令行复制快捷键速览
linux命令行 复制快捷键

首页 2024-12-13 06:14:34



探索Linux命令行:掌握复制快捷键的高效之道 在数字时代的洪流中,Linux操作系统以其开源、稳定、高效的特点,吸引了无数开发者、系统管理员以及技术爱好者的青睐

    而Linux命令行,作为这一强大操作系统的灵魂,更是承载了无数高效工作流的秘诀

    在Linux命令行环境中,掌握复制快捷键,无疑是提升工作效率、优化操作流程的关键一步

    本文将深入探讨Linux命令行中的复制快捷键及其高效应用,帮助读者在这一领域中更进一步

     一、Linux命令行基础:为何重要? 首先,让我们简要回顾一下Linux命令行的重要性

    在Linux系统中,命令行提供了一个强大而灵活的接口,允许用户直接与操作系统内核交互,执行各种管理任务、文件操作、网络配置等

    相较于图形用户界面(GUI),命令行界面(CLI)以其高效、脚本化、可定制的特点,成为了专业用户的首选

    通过简单的命令组合,用户可以快速完成复杂任务,减少点击次数,提高工作效率

     二、Linux命令行中的复制与粘贴 在Linux命令行中,复制与粘贴操作是日常工作的基础

    不同于Windows或macOS中的Ctrl+C和Ctrl+V快捷键,Linux命令行采用了一套独特的快捷键体系,这些快捷键基于Shell(如Bash、Zsh等)的文本处理功能,为用户提供了一种更为直接、高效的操作方式

     2.1 基本复制与粘贴快捷键 - 复制(剪切)文本:在Linux命令行中,通常使用`Ctrl+Shift+C`(或`Ctrl+U`选中后按`Ctrl+K`剪切)来复制选中的文本

    这里的“选中”通常通过鼠标拖拽或使用键盘快捷键(如`Shift+箭头键`)完成

    值得注意的是,并非所有终端模拟器都支持`Ctrl+Shift+C`作为复制快捷键,有时`Ctrl+Insert`也能起到相同作用,这取决于终端的配置

     - 粘贴文本:相应的,粘贴操作则通过`Ctrl+Shift+V`(或`Shift+Insert`)实现

    这些快捷键将剪贴板中的内容插入到当前光标位置

     2.2 使用Shell内置命令 除了上述快捷键外,Linux命令行还提供了多种基于Shell命令的复制粘贴方法,这些方法在处理大量文本或自动化任务时尤为有效

     - echo与重定向:对于简单的文本复制,可以使用`echo`命令配合重定向符号(``或`]`)将文本写入文件

    例如,`echo Hello, World! > filename.txt`会将文本“Hello, World!”复制到`filename.txt`文件中

     - cat与管道:对于已存在的文件内容,可以使用`cat`命令结合管道(`|`)和其他命令进行复制或处理

    例如,`cat source.txt | tee destination.txt`会将`source.txt`的内容复制到`destination.txt`,同时也在终端显示

     - xargs与awk:对于更复杂的文本处理需求,`xargs`和`awk`等工具能够实现对文本的筛选、转换和复制

    例如,`cat source.txt |awk {print $1} > newfile.txt`会将`source.txt`中的第一列复制到`newfile.txt`

     三、高效利用复制快捷键的实践案例 了解了Linux命令行中的复制快捷键及基础命令后,接下来通过几个实践案例,展示如何在不同场景下高效利用这些技巧

     3.1 快速编辑配置文件 在Linux系统中,编辑配置文件是常见任务

    通过命令行复制快捷键,可以迅速复制旧配置中的某些参数到新文件中,进行比对或修改

    例如,编辑`/etc/nginx/nginx.conf`时,可以先用`Ctrl+Shift+C`复制旧配置中的一段,然后切换到新配置文件,使用`Ctrl+Shift+V`粘贴,再进行必要的调整

     3.2 脚本自动化 在编写Shell脚本时,经常需要复用之前的命令或文本片段

    此时,可以使用终端的历史命令搜索功能(通常是`Ctrl+R`),找到之前的

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道